The earliest particular person church legislation was named a canon (Greek kanōn, “rule, measure, normal”), as well as the canons came to be called canon regulation. Church legislation appeared Virtually once church authority, plus some passages of the New Testomony reflect early policies; whether they ought to be named “legislation” at this primitive phase is Uncertain. Legal guidelines of dioceses or of areas have been shaped by diocesan synods or regional councils even right before Constantine. Legislation for The complete church show up with the earliest ecumenical councils. Collections of canon regulation, which were being produced through the entire Center Ages, include the vital codes of Burchard of Worms and Ivo of Chartres, even though the main definitive codification was built only about 1140 by Gratian in the Decretum Gratiani.
